I just got back from a library that carries up-to-date comics (only downside is you have to read in house). I thought I would voice my opinion of the assorted comics I read.

 

Ultimate Fantastic Four - some of the best stories I have read in a while. Great art and very cool storyline. I may get this book or at least kep reading it at the library.

 

Punisher War Journal - Another great story and decent artwork. I really enjoyed the whole Cap - vs - Punisher stories.

 

Conan - pretty good typical Conan stories with good artwork. Will keep reading.

 

Batman - Regular series is keeping my interest but I just am not blown away like the previous year. Good artwork for a DC title.

 

Superman - Kind of plain-jane but entertaining.

 

Wolverine - Can't say I was blown away but liked the images of Wolverine getting his head nearly cutt off and then burned to his sceleton and each time ending up in limbo. Cool idea.

 

Uncanny X-Men - Just ok. I really am having a problem getting into any of the X-Men series other than Ultimate. Ok art and nothing mind-blowing on the art.

 

Civil War - Coolest idea to come from a comic in many, many years. I am actually curious to see how it all plays out. Good art on top of all that. Go Marvel!!

 

Super Girl - I like this series. Great art and the story is very entertaining.

 

Fantastic Four - Not nearly as good as the Ultimate series but a great read with up-to-date stories. Who would have thought the F4 would be my favorite read??

 

Ultimates - Read a TPB and that story is GREAT!! I wish all comics could be like this series. Art is top notch.

 

Daredevil - Pretty good art but fantastic stories. Keeps me coming back each month.

 

All in all - I really like almost every story in the list. The X-Men titles are really falling behind and I may not bother reading if things down turn around.

Punisher War Journal has been a slight suprise to me. Not great, but definitely fun to read each month. It's not Ennis, but it's nice to have a non-Ennis Punisher every once in awhile.

 

Batman is starting to tank for me again. Dini's stuff is not bad. The Quinn story wasn't that great. Neither was the villain with the plastique explosives. They sure seem to be coming out quickly though (bi-weekly). I'm really disappointed with Morrison & Kubert's Batman. Again, not bad. Just think that a creative team like that should have something golden.

 

Superman's a tough one for me. He's a character that needs the absolute best creative team. I loved the Donner/Johns combo. Some great books too. Recently, without them, it's been good enough. But I'm not sure how long it can hold my interest. Of course, the Phantom Zone stories are always intriguing. I'm just afraid that they are going to mess it up (recent Supergirl issue explaining the other view of the Phantom Zone is leaving me unsure).

 

Civil War. Only read it if it's free. Even then, it's probably a waste. Great concept originally. Horrible execution.
